Search our database by NPI, name, address, etc.

David Abbenda

NPI: 1538667514

David Abbenda is a specialist focused health provider in Albany, New York. affiliates with no hospitals or medical groups. Call David Abbenda on phone number 5185496379 for more information and advice or to book an appointment.

CityAlbany
StateNew York
Address 175 NEW SCOTLAND AVE
Postal Code12208
Phone5185496379

Leave your review: